Replacement Nissan Keys

Most modern cars are fitted with a key fob that allows the owner to open and lock their doors as well as start the engine, and operate other functions. The key fob has a small transponder chip that transmits a signal to the ignition system of the vehicle once the key is inserted. If the signal is not correct, the car will not start and it will likely display an error code on the dashboard. If this happens, you'll require an alternative Nissan key.

Car keys are more complex than ever and it's not uncommon for keys to fail completely or malfunction over time. This can happen due to wear and wear, exposure to elements, or the simple use of it regularly. It is best to keep a spare in a secure location and to have it made. Many automakers let you program an extra key on your own and the instructions are usually easy to follow. If you are not sure how to get a new nissan key to program a new key, you can find steps-by-step instructions on the internet for your model.

It is important to have the correct battery for your key fob in order to ensure it's functioning properly. You can find batteries at many automotive parts stores and there are a variety of options to choose from. It is important to choose one that is the same size as your original. The battery's size is indicated by the numbers like CR2032, 2025. If you choose the wrong size, the key fob won't function properly.

Make sure you request an emergency key when you contact a locksmith or dealer who will cut the new key. If your key fob is damaged or lost, you'll still unlock the doors and trunk. The emergency key should contain the same code as the original and it is recommended you keep the code in a safe location. This will make it simple to replace the key in the event of a malfunction and stop you from having to pay for additional services.

Worn/Snapped Nissan Keys

The good part is that a damaged or snapped key can usually be repaired. If the internal components of the key are damaged or malfunctioning, then replacing it is the best choice. Traditional keys are relatively simple in design and a locksmith can usually straighten them or cut them again if they become severely bent. Smart keys have more intricate electronic components which makes them more difficult to repair.

The traditional key was simply a keyblade that was cut to match your locks cylinders for your doors and ignition. The technological advancements have led to the development of smart keys and fobs that enable you to start your car from a distance or unlock it from a distance. These keys require a set of tools and the skills only a locksmith can provide.

While it might seem appealing to to save money and replace your Nissan key by yourself or using an unlicensed company but these methods can be dangerous. They can also damage the locks on your vehicle and also the ignition system. This can add up to massive costs and stress.

Nissan keys can also protect your vehicle from theft. Modern keys usually have a chip which allows them to connect with computers in your car. The computer recognizes these unique codes and identifies the owner of the key. This means that if the key is lost it will only work once the correct code is entered into the car's computer.
